Transaction fc94dfc03eceb538a211c1b214cce05cb8ad54a3b58fa1a59151c0379bac5722
1 Input
1 Output
-
fc94dfc03eceb538a211c1b214cce05cb8ad54a3b58fa1a59151c0379bac5722:0
- value
- 976346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a3af4373f66195e2eb1ef53144cce56d64c642a OP_EQUAL
- address
- 3QW7UhFncBoQJyUg1ZoeXgLYVLax84nZPz